Interesting Facts & Symbolism:
-
Not a Thistle: Despite its appearance, it belongs to the Apiaceae family, making it a distant relative of carrots and celery.
-
Candied Roots: In the past, specifically during the Victorian era, its roots were often candied and enjoyed as a delicacy believed to have romantic properties.
-
The Symbol of Independence: In the language of flowers, it stands for independence, severity, and austerity.
-
Eternal Beauty: Eryngium is famous for maintaining its color and shape perfectly when dried, making it a sustainable choice for decor.
